main achievements
Grammar usage guide and real-world examplesUSAGE SUMMARY
The phrase "main achievements"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used to refer to the most significant accomplishments or successes in a particular context, such as a person's career, a project's outcomes, or an organization's milestones. Example: "The report highlights the main achievements of the team over the past year, including the successful launch of the new product."

Linguistic Context
The phrase "main achievements" functions as a noun phrase, typically serving as the subject or object of a sentence. It identifies the most important accomplishments or successes. As evidenced by Ludwig, the phrase is commonly used to summarize key outcomes.

FAQs
How can I effectively present the "main achievements" of a project?
Start with a concise summary, then elaborate on each achievement with specific details and supporting data. Use a clear and structured format to enhance readability.
What are some alternatives to "main achievements"?
You can use alternatives like "key accomplishments", "primary accomplishments", or "major accomplishments" depending on the context.
What distinguishes "main achievements" from regular accomplishments?
The "main achievements" represent the most significant and impactful results, while regular accomplishments may include smaller, less crucial successes.
When is it appropriate to use the phrase "main achievements"?
Use "main achievements" when you want to highlight the most important accomplishments in a specific context, such as a project review, performance evaluation, or historical overview.
